#!/usr/bin/env fun /* * This file is part of the Fun programming language. * https://fun-lang.xyz/ * * Copyright 2026 Johannes Findeisen * Licensed under the terms of the Apache-2.0 license. * https://opensource.org/license/apache-2-0 * * Added: 2026-04-02 */ /* * Demonstrates nested functions that are only visible inside the * outer function where they are defined. This example avoids * capturing outer variables (closures) and instead passes values * explicitly, which works with the current implementation. */ print("=== Nested functions (local to outer function) ===") // Outer function defines two inner helpers that are only usable inside outer fun outer(a, b) // Defined inside outer; not visible as a global symbol fun times3(x) return x * 3 // Another local helper; also only visible within outer fun sum_plus1(x, y) return x + y + 1 // Use the local helpers t1 = times3(a) t2 = times3(b) return sum_plus1(t1, t2) print("outer(2, 5) -> expected 2*3 + 5*3 + 1 = 22") print(outer(2, 5)) print("") print("=== Deeper nesting without variable capture ===") // Demonstrates function-inside-function-inside-function. // Each level avoids referencing outer locals directly; values // are threaded through parameters instead. fun demo_deep(n) fun one(x) fun two(y) fun three(z) return z + 1 return three(y) + 1 return two(x) + 1 return one(n) print("demo_deep(4) -> expected 7") print(demo_deep(4)) /* Expected output: === Nested functions (local to outer function) === outer(2, 5) -> expected 2*3 + 5*3 + 1 = 22 22 === Deeper nesting without variable capture === demo_deep(4) -> expected 7 7 */
